Community Integrated Management Plan Faleata East - Upolu Implementation Guidelines 2018 COMMUNITY INTEGRATED MANAGEMENT PLAN IMPLEMENTATION GUIDELINES Foreword It is with great pleasure that I present the new Community Integrated Management (CIM) Plans, formerly known as Coastal Infrastructure Management (CIM) Plans. The revised CIM Plans recognizes the change in approach since the first set of fifteen CIM Plans were developed from 2002-2003 under the World Bank funded Infrastructure Asset Management Project (IAMP) , and from 2004-2007 for the remaining 26 districts, under the Samoa Infrastructure Asset Management (SIAM) Project. With a broader geographic scope well beyond the coastal environment, the revised CIM Plans now cover all areas from the ridge-to-reef, and includes the thematic areas of not only infrastructure, but also the environment and biological resources, as well as livelihood sources and governance. The CIM Strategy, from which the CIM Plans were derived from, was revised in August 2015 to reflect the new expanded approach and it emphasizes the whole of government approach for planning and implementation, taking into consideration an integrated ecosystem based adaptation approach and the ridge to reef concept. The timeframe for implementation and review has also expanded from five years to ten years as most of the solutions proposed in the CIM Plan may take several years to realize. The CIM Plans is envisaged as the blueprint for climate change interventions across all development sectors – reflecting the programmatic approach to climate resilience adaptation taken by the Government of Samoa. The proposed interventions outlined in the CIM Plans are also linked to the Strategy for the Development of Samoa 2016/17 – 2019/20 and the relevant ministry sector plans. -

Acknowledgements We thank the following individuals for their contribution to this work: Marcos Gorresen, Adam Miles, Jorge Palmeirim, Dave Waldien, Dick Watling, and Gary Wiles. ii Executive Summary This Species Report uses the best available scientific and commercial information to assess the status of the semicaudata subspecies of the Pacific sheath-tailed bat, Emballonura semicaudata semicaudata. This subspecies is found in southern Polynesia, eastern Melanesia, and Micronesia. Three additional subspecies of E. semicaudata (E.s. rotensis, E.s. palauensis, and E.s. sulcata) are not discussed here unless they are used to support assumptions about E.s. semicaudata, or to fill in data gaps in this analysis. The Pacific sheath-tailed bat is an Old-World bat in the family Emballonuridae, and is found in parts of Polynesia, eastern Melanesia, and Micronesia. It is the only insectivorous bat recorded from much of this area. -

Signature Date: 01/07/15 Name: Dr Eleanor John Designation: Principal Supervisor ABSTRACT Samoan volcanism is tectonically controlled and is generated by tension-stress activities associated with the sharp bend in the Pacific Plate (Northern Terminus) at the Tonga Trench. The Samoan island chain dominated by a mixture of shield and post-erosional volcanism activities. The closed basin structures of volcanoes such as the Crater Lake Lanoto enable the entrapment and retention of a near-complete sedimentary record, itself recording its eruptive history. Crater Lanoto is characterised as a compound monogenetic and short-term volcano. A high proportion of primary tephra components were found in a core extracted from Crater Lake Lanoto show that Crater Lanoto erupted four times (tephra bed-1, 2, 3, and 4). -

Samoa - Lingard et al. 103 RECONSTRUCTED CATCHES OF SAMOA 1950–20101 Stephanie Lingard, Sarah Harper, and Dirk Zeller Sea Around Us Project, Fisheries Centre, University of British Columbia, 2202 Main Mall, Vancouver, BC, V6T 1Z4, Canada [email protected]; [email protected]; [email protected] ABSTRACT Samoa has a long history of marine resource use, and today maintains a strong connection to the marine environment. Despite the acknowledged importance of marine resources for food security, Samoan fisheries landings have been under-reported since the FAO started reporting fisheries catch data on behalf of Samoa in 1950. Catches are particularly under-represented in the early years, but reporting has improved somewhat since the 1990s. Using a consumption-based approach, we linked historical information with current patterns of marine resource use to create a complete time series of total marine fisheries catches over the 1950 to 2010 time period. Estimated total marine fisheries catches were 627,700 t for the 1950-2010 period, which is 2.8 times the reported landings submitted to the FAO of almost 220,900 t. In recent years, total reconstructed catches included estimates of under-reported subsistence and artisanal catches, by-catch and discards. This study illustrates the importance of small-scale fishing in Samoa, as well as a need for better monitoring of all fisheries sub-sectors to prevent further declines in fisheries resources vital to food security. INTRODUCTION Samoa, a small Pacific island country, is comprised of two large islands (Savai’i and Upolu), and seven small islets (two of which, Manono and Apolima, are inhabited). -

DENGUE SEROTYPE 2 OUTBREAK IN SAMOA, 2017/2018. Ministry of Health SITREP nO.9 18th March 2018 Outbreak overview. The situational analysis of the dengue fever outbreak in Samoa as shown in the graph below portrays a continual decrease in the number of cases over the past 10 weeks. The cumulative total as of March 18th is 3,255 with a national attack rate of 16.6 per 1,000 population. Dengue fever continues to spread geographically mostly in the Apia Urban and North West Upolu regions. Majority of those af- fected are 5 - 9 year olds which makes up 31% of the total cases. There has not been any dengue related deaths reported hence the total dengue-related mortality remains at 5. Dengue case definition: An acute fever with any two of the following signs and symptoms: joint & muscle pains; maculo- pappular rash; severe headaches; nausea & vomiting; pains behind the eyes; bleeding and leucopenia. Time: dengue epi-curve Person: age group & sex Sex No of Cases % Female 1570 48% Male 1685 52% Total 3255 100% Control measures continues... SOURCE REDUCTION remains highly recommended for control of mosquito breeding sites during this rainy season. Other usual prevention methods to avoid illness is also advised. An integrated response has seen communities and organizations work with MOH to use chemical spraying in their respective locations. MOH Samoa continues to advocate and implement control measures for mosquito–borne diseases. Grassroots groups involved in vector control are mobilizing the affected communities to actively participate in source reduction and clean-up campaigns. Vector surveillance and control efforts continue.
